20

今天早上,当我尝试在 Vim 中打开文件时,我开始收到该消息。Vim 是我选择的配置文件、git 提交消息等的编辑器,但不是我的日常代码编辑器。我显然做了一些事情来邀请这个消息,但我不知道是什么。我最近确实从 中卸载了旧版本的 XCode /Developer-3.2.6,但这是我想到的唯一一件似乎甚至是切线相关的事情。

我正在运行 OSX Lion。Excuberant ctags 是基础安装的一部分吗?我知道我不是故意安装它,但如果它不是本机的,那么它可能与其他东西一起出现?关于如何取回插件或删除对它的引用的任何想法,所以我没有收到警告消息?

谢谢。

4

7 回答 7

42

对于 Ubuntu 和衍生产品:

sudo apt-get install exuberant-ctags

百胜:

sudo yum install ctags-etags
于 2013-07-19T02:36:12.570 回答
14

FWIW 我在 Ubuntu 上遇到了同样的错误消息,我只是安装了ctags和一切 hunky dory。谢谢 :)

于 2011-10-13T08:53:10.153 回答
8

这看起来很像taglist插件在找不到 ctags 程序时发出的消息。如果您运行:scriptnames,您是否plugin/taglist.vim在源文件列表中看到?如果你这样做了,那么你可能想要删除它并doc/taglist.txt在相同的目录结构下。

于 2011-09-17T12:49:33.720 回答
6

如果你在Windows系统下使用Gvim,你应该下载一个ctag Windows程序(即ctag.exe)并将ctag.exe放在vim74文件目录下,然后重启Gvim,它就会找到并使用它!我希望这是有帮助的。

看看这个:http: //vim-taglist.sourceforge.net/installation.html

于 2014-02-26T09:10:36.847 回答
1

多谢你们。我最终重新安装了 XCode,看起来问题已经消失了。我不知道我是如何让它进入任何状态的,但它现在又回来了,一切看起来都恢复了正常。

于 2011-09-17T17:35:54.010 回答
0

升级到 Mountain Lion 后,我遇到了同样的问题。我通过从 XCode 首选项 > 下载重新安装 CLI 工具来修复它。我在升级之前安装了 CLI 工具。不知道发生了什么,但它现在有效。

于 2012-11-29T20:59:29.407 回答
0

我在主机上遇到了这个问题,但我没有安装任何软件包的权限。

但我确实发现gctags该系统上存在。

I created a softlink for the gctags binary in a location that was included in my PATH environment variable.

$ln -s /usr/bin/gctags ~/bin/ctags**

You can do the same if you find etags binary in your system, and have no way to install any packages.

于 2019-07-31T06:11:24.017 回答